Important Information
All rabbits must be pre-registered. Please mail entries to
the address listed below. Deadline is September 1st.
Entry address - P.O. Box 968, La Plata, MD, 20646
Entries will be accepted Tuesday 3-8 pm and Wednesday 1-7
pm.
All rabbits will be inspected for bad teeth and health problems
before being cooped. Any rabbit showing signs of sickness
must be removed from the grounds.
Exhibitors are responsible for entry day feeding, watering and
bedding before leaving the barn area. Rabbits will be fed and
watered daily by staff during the Fair.
No rabbit may be removed prior to 6 pm on Sunday.
Exhibitors with 1- 4 entries may coop out Sunday or Monday,
but due to barn area congestion, exhibitors with 5 or more are
requested to coop out Monday 9 am to noon or 5 – 8 pm.
All reasonable care will be taken, however, the Charles
County Fair and its volunteers will not be responsible for any
accident, loss or damage for any reason.
Please remember we are an all volunteer organization. If you
would like to help out, please contact the superintendent.
Rabbits will be judged by the ARBA Standard of Perfection.
Please specify breed and correct color variety.
Mixed breed rabbits are limited to 1 per youth exhibitor. Open
exhibitor may not show mixed or crossbred rabbits, only
recognized breeds will be accepted, unless in spayed or
neutered house pet.
Open and youth recognized breed classes are limited to 2
entries per class per exhibitor.
